Below are the newest statistics for the 2008-2009.
BC LAW Student Body--2008-2009 Total Enrollment................... ............................. ...................800 Male......................... ............................. ............................. .....50% Female....................... ............................. ............................. ...50% Students of Color........................ ............................. ..............25% International................ ............................. ............................. ..2%
Graduates Employed..................... ............................. .............98% Median Starting Salary Private Sector....................... ..............$135,000
2008 Entering Class Number of applicants................... ............................. .............6609 Enrolled students..................... ............................. ..................299
Median GPA 25th percentile................... ............................. .......................3.49 75th percentile................... ............................. .......................3.77
Median LSAT 25th percentile................... ............................. ........................162 75th percentile................... ............................. ........................165
Median LSAT ............................. ............................. ................164 Median GPA ............................. ............................. .................3.64
Ranking Tier: 1 US News Ranking: 26th
Applications Deadline: March 1 Decisions sent on a rolling basis January to May 1 If accepted, many applicants are notified during mid- to late-February, usually before March 1
Early Notification Program Submit application by November 1 Complete application by November 19 Decisions are mailed on December 12
Note to URM and other disadvantaged applicants Boston College Law School's applicant allows for you to submit a supplemental diversity statement to discuss issues of your background that may have created special obstacles for you. Question #7

« on: April 24, 2008, 04:17:52 PM »
Mistakes #1 I sent out the wrong e-mail address to UCLA, thus bouncing every single e-mail they sent me for an entire half year and missing a bunch of important information. I realized this mistake at the point when they waitlisted me.
#2 Not taking an LSAT prep course.
#3 Asking for recommendations only a couple months before I needed them, instead of earlier.
